05-17-2009 09:57 PM
05-18-2009 12:42 PM
05-19-2009 09:17 PM
05-29-2009 04:03 AM
06-02-2009 07:41 PM
private void getNodes(){
…
…
MapNode node = new MapNode(nodeRef, this.getNodeService(), true);
node.addPropertyResolver("smallIcon",
this.browseBean.resolverSmallIcon);
node.addPropertyResolver("childNumber",
this.resolverChildNumber);
…
…
}
public NodePropertyResolver resolverChildNumber = new NodePropertyResolver() {
@SuppressWarnings("unchecked")
public Object get(Node node) {
Map cha = node.getChildAssociations();
Object key = cha.get("{http://www.alfresco.org/model/content/1.0}contains");
List<ChildAssociationRef> charef = (List<ChildAssociationRef>) key;
int nbNode = charef.size();
return (nbNode < 0 ? 0 : nbNode);
}
};
…
…
<a:actionLink id="col2-act2" value="#{r.name} (#{r.childNumber})" actionListener="#{BrowseBean.clickSpace}" styleClass="header">
<f:param name="id" value="#{r.id}" />
</a:actionLink>
…
…Tags
Find what you came for
We want to make your experience in Hyland Connect as valuable as possible, so we put together some helpful links.